Al Jazeera English to air film about Armenian Genocide
Al Jazeera English is to air a Swedish production film “Grandma’s Tattoos,” directed by Suzanne Khardalian from January 11 to 18. The film is dedicated to the Armenian Genocide.
According to Khardalian everything started with the idea of shooting a film on the victims of Ruanda Genocide. Studying the subject she discovered photos in French archives which reminded her about the tattoos that her grandmother had on her face and body.
She believes these signs witnessed the violence and sufferings which hundreds of thousands of Armenians passed through.
Writer and director Khardalian is an author of more than 20 films which have been presented in the US and Europe, the regnum reports.
